Group HR Compliance Manager

Connect with our employees, protect our values. As HR Compliance Manager at Richemont, you'll build relationships, ensure ethical practices, and foster a culture of trust and compliance.

HOW WILL YOU MAKE AN IMPACT?

The HR Compliance Manager is responsible for ensuring the organization's adherence to all relevant labor laws, regulations, and company HR policies. This role involves developing, implementing, and monitoring compliance programs, conducting HR investigations, and providing guidance to HR and management on HR compliance-related matters under the supervision of Group HR Governance & Compliance Director.

In this role, your key responsibilities will include:

  • Developing, implementing, and maintaining HR compliance documentation, including policies, procedures, and training materials, with a focus with a focus on key HR areas (Talent, Learning & development, Compensation & benefits and HR data) and ethical conduct
  • In collaboration with our Legal and Compliance Teams, staying up-to-date on changes in HR related regulations and employment law, and communicating these changes to relevant stakeholders as well as proposing actions to ensure compliance
  • Leading internal investigations related to HR compliance issues, such as harassment, discrimination, and ethical violations, working closely with HR Business Partners and Legal Counsels
  • Developing and delivering training programs on HR compliance topics for HR community, employees and managers, with a focus on practical application and real-world scenarios
  • Preparing and presenting reports on HR compliance activities to HR senior management providing insights and recommendations for continuous improvement of HR compliance programs
  • Providing expert support and advice to the HR Department on compliance-related matters, including policy interpretation, risk assessment, and best practices in HR compliance, ensuring consistent application of HR policies and procedures
  • Collaborating with internal Sustainability teams on HR-related reporting requirements, ensuring accurate and timely reporting of HR metrics related to diversity, equity, and inclusion, and other sustainability initiatives
  • Partnering with HR Business Partners to conduct regular HR compliance audits and risk assessments, identifying potential areas of non-compliance and developing corrective action plans
  • Supporting the HR team in responding to employee complaints and grievances, ensuring fair and consistent application of HR policies and procedures, and working to resolve issues in a timely and effective manner
